Security Token
Definition
A token that represents ownership of an asset, such as a stock or real estate.
Deep Dive
A security token is a digital asset that represents ownership of an underlying real-world asset, such as equity in a company, real estate, bonds, or investment funds, through tokenization on a blockchain. Unlike utility tokens which grant access to a service, security tokens are designed to function as traditional securities but with the added benefits of blockchain technology, including fractional ownership, increased liquidity for illiquid assets, global accessibility, and faster settlement times.
